Step 1: Assessment and Planning

Our team will assess the damage and create a customized restoration plan that meets your specific needs and budget. We’ll identify the source of the water damage and find out the extent of the damage. We’ll then create a timeline for the restoration process and communicate it to you.

Step 2: Water Extraction

Our technicians will use specialized equipment, including pumps and vacuums, to extract the water from your home. We’ll use a combination of techniques to remove standing water, including wet vacuums and extractors. Our goal is to dry the affected area as quickly and efficiently as possible.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

After the water has been extracted, our team will use specialized equipment to dry and dehumidify the affected area. We’ll use desiccants and dehumidifiers to remove any remaining moisture from the air. Our goal is to ensure that your home is dry and free from any moisture-related issues.

Step 4: Repair and Replacement

Finally, our team will repair and replace any damaged materials, including flooring, walls, and ceilings. We’ll use high-quality materials that are resistant to water damage. We’ll also ensure that all repairs are done to code and meet local building standards.

Residential Water Damage Restoration Cost in Shoreline, WA

The cost of residential water damage restoration can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Shoreline, WA. Here are some estimated costs for different aspects of the restoration process: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ction and drying $500 – $2,500 The size of the affected area and the amount of water extracted
Repair and replacement of damaged materials $1,000 – $5,000 The type of materials replaced and the extent of the damage
Dehumidification and drying $500 – $2,000 The size of the affected area and the amount of moisture removed
Disinfection and sanitizing $200 – $1,000 The type of disinfectant used and the extent of the disinfection required
Moisture testing and inspection $100 – $500 The size of the affected area and the type of testing required
